Alzai Health teams up with Centauri Health to market AI-driven Alzheimer’s risk identification in US

  • Alzai Health signed a U.S. commercialization teaming agreement with Centauri Health Solutions to market AI-driven Alzheimer’s risk stratification.
  • Centauri will use its provider and health plan relationships to support rollout across Medicare Advantage and other value-based care settings.
  • Alzai will provide its proprietary risk identification platform and technical expertise to accelerate a U.S. launch.
  • The partners are targeting earlier identification of high-risk patients for early-stage, undiagnosed Alzheimer’s disease.
  • The release cited more than 7 million U.S. patients, with direct care costs estimated at $384 billion annually.
